We do not know why Abram did not take his share. He accepted goods from *Pharaoh in Egypt. (See Genesis 12:16.) And he accepted goods from Abimelech. (See Genesis 20:14; Genesis 20:16.) But he did not accept these goods. Perhaps Abram knew that the inhabitants of Sodom and Gomorrah were wicked. (See Genesis 18:20.) And he did not want people to say that his wealth came from wicked people. Perhaps that was the reason.

Canaan ~ the country where the Canaanites lived. (See Canaanites.) It is approximately the same land as the modern country Israel together with the land of the Palestinians.

Canaanites ~ Canaan’s descendants. Canaan was a grandson of Noah. (see Genesis 9:18.) The word Canaanites included Amorites and Hivites and other nations. (see Genesis 10:16-17.) It sometimes also included other people who lived in the country Canaan. These people were not descendants of Canaan.

Hebrew ~ the Hebrew people were Abraham and his descendants. The ancient Hebrew language is the original language of Genesis. It is also the original language of most of the Old Testament (the first part of the Bible). This language is like the modern Hebrew language, which people speak in the country Israel today.

tribe ~ a large group of people who are relatives of each other. Judah’s descendants were called ‘the tribe of Judah’. In a similar way, each of the 12 sons of Israel became a tribe. But Joseph’s descendants were not called ‘the tribe of Joseph’. They were the tribes of Ephraim and Manasseh. Ephraim and Manasseh were Joseph’s sons.

righteous ~ to be right with God; people whom God sees as clean and not his enemies; people who do what is right; just, good.
Lord ~ a lord is a person who has authority. ‘The Lord’ means God. It is a translation of God’s name. The Hebrews wrote God’s name as YHWH. We may write it as Yahweh.

Pharaoh ~ every king of Egypt was called ‘Pharaoh’. It was not one king’s name.
